Tigers are fascinating creatures, and there are some shocking facts about them that may surprise you. Firstly, tigers are the largest members of the cat family, with males growing up to 11 feet long and weighing over 650 pounds. Secondly, they are incredibly fast and can reach speeds of up to 40 mph. Another surprising fact is that tigers have striped skin as well as fur, which helps them blend in with their surroundings.

Tigers have also been known to eat up to 80 pounds of meat in one meal, making them formidable hunters. Additionally, tigers are strong swimmers and are not afraid to take on crocodiles in the water. Despite their ferocious reputation, tigers are solitary animals and prefer to live alone. Furthermore, tigers have a unique way of communicating with each other, using vocalizations and scent marking to establish territories. Lastly, tigers are endangered due to habitat loss and poaching, making conservation efforts crucial to their survival. These shocking facts about tigers highlight the incredible nature of these majestic creatures and the need for their protection.
